Sam Starr, Intrepid Explorer

Agnes's death was a shock to all of us.  I mean at her age we all knew it could happen at any time, but we all expected that she would go peacefully of old age, not some horrible blow torch accident.  We moved her monument out to the family cemetery where she and Lucia, our former butler, seem to be keeping each other company.



Things were pretty rough here for a while afterwards.  Jess took it very hard and Jemma kept bouncing between Jess and Jackson trying to console them.  She has such a tender heart.




Slowly things returned to normal.  Jess devoted herself to her family and her art.




Jackson spent time with his granddaughters and even went out to a party, something he hasn't done in a long time.




The girls have started school.  They are both straight A students.  Jemma comes home from school each day and does her homework without even being reminded.  Jori likes to play in the back yard for a while before she settles in to her homework, but she always gets it done.  I'm so proud of them!




Of course they find time to hang out and play video games.  Jess and Jackson are quite famous now and we recently were sent a big screen TV in recognition of all they have done for Sunset Valley.  Fame definitely has its perks.



Something always seems to be going on at our house.  Lucia makes nearly daily appearances.  She seem to likes to sleep in the sarcophagus in our treasure room.  Agnes has even shown up once or twice.  Even in death she's quite a character.  



We've also had an infestation of gnomes.  I have to remember to talk to Jess about calling an exterminator.



Once things had settled down around here I got the urge to do some adventuring.  Jess didn't want to take the girls out of school, so she packed my bags and shipped me off to Egypt.  My plan is to explore every tomb and pyramid I can find so that I can build us a vacation home there.  That way future generations of Starrs will have beautifully appointed houses in China and Egypt whenever they want to travel.  I would love more than anything to build a home in France, too, but I am days away from my elder birthday, so I'm not sure if there will be time for that.

My trip was fairly uneventful - just a lot of tomb raiding.  But I did have a particularly nasty run in with a local in the basement of someone's home...



Fortunately I had a few Scooby Mummy Snacks which gave me plenty of time to escape before things got ugly.  I don't have many pictures of my trip - Jess is the photographer in the family.   Despite my best efforts, I had to fly back right before I reached a level 3 visa - I was on my way to turn in the opportunity that would put me over the top when I realized that I was going to miss my flight if I didn't head to the airport immediately.  Jess was a good sport and sent me back for a short trip as soon as I got over my jet lag.  On my second trip I managed to buy some land and oversee the construction and decoration of our Egyptian hideaway.

It is 'U' shaped with a central courtyard that houses a hot tub.  The walls that open on to the courtyard are all glass so that no matter where we are in the house we can enjoy the view.  I had the builders put a staircase in so we can add a second floor in the future.  Here are some photos - I'm quite proud of how it turned out and can't wait for the family to see it!

Teenagers Kick Our Butt*

We had a lot going on when Sam got home from Egypt the second time.  Dad has finally decided to retire from the Bistro.  He didn't want a big party - we were all still kind of shell shocked after losing Mom.  We kept it simple and surprised him with cake and confetti when he came in from the garden one evening.



Next up was the girls' teen birthday.  There was no way we could avoid a party for such an important family occasion.  Dad, Sam and I held our breath as the guests started to arrive.

First Jori blew out her candles, then Jemma did.



I can't believe my daughters are turning into young ladies!




We all settled in to enjoy the buffet and some cake when we heard a commotion in the front yard...OH NO!







Sure enough, Grim had done it again.  This time it was my dear friend, Hank Goddard.  I was crushed...did I remember to put out the plasma fruit?!  

Then Grim started making goo goo eyes at Sam!!!  As we later found it was only to reprimand him for having such a filthy shower...




I swear Grim must still feel guilty about taking Lucia from us!

I'm not proud to say I sank back into a depression that not even the moodlet manager could fix.  I don't know what I would do without Sam and Dad.  Sam immediately made travel arrangements for all of us to go to our home in China for 3 weeks.  Dad decided to stay home and take care of our latest casualty.  I hope he's finding time to play in the sprinklers, he enjoys that so.

When we got to China I thought Sam had lost his mind.  He pulled up to a fancy house that was not at all how I remembered our cozy vacation home.  He told me that he was inspired to remodel after seeing how well the house in Egypt turned out.  Color me impressed, who knew my husband has the soul of an architect?!

The first order of business was to get the girls' portraits and Jori's sculpture out of the way.  I'm so proud of Sam, this is his first ice Sim!



Jori has been very single minded about learning the martial arts ever since she was a child, so we picked China specifically so she could attend the academy.  She spent the first day in the Scholar's Garden studying the basics.



The next day it was off to the academy for more formal training.  





It definitely hasn't been easy going, but we're four days into our trip and Jori is already a blue belt.  We're all so proud of her!

Jemma is more of a home body.  She has her heart set on a career in science, so she has her nose buried in gardening books or is watching the gardening channel on TV whenever she gets the chance.  She's also started fishing.  I think I'll suggest that Sam take her to some of the fishing spots we found on our last trip here.

Sam is spending his time sculpting and painting.  He's getting very good at both.  Perhaps I should sneak him some ambrosia and let him take care of the museum pieces for future generations...

I'm really focused on painting.  I need to sell $15,000 worth of paintings to achieve level 10 in my career.  I've painted at least 5 masterpieces in the last 4 days, so I should have no problem reaching my goal once Sam takes them to the consignment shop back home.  Then all that's left is to secure my 6 best friends and have my elder museum pieces crafted.  As much as I hoped Mom would be around to do the honors, I know Sam will do an amazing job.

I call Dad every day to make sure he's doing okay.   He's been hanging out with Lucia, she seems to want to join him for his daily nap in the sarcophagus.  I don't understand why everyone wants to sleep in that darn thing.  The one time Sam convinced me to woo hoo in one I thought I would pass out from claustrophobia!  To this day Sam thinks it was his prowess that made me swoon and I let him go right on thinking that.   ;)  It's my secret to a happy marriage!

We still have 2 and a half weeks to spend here, so I'm hopeful Jori will earn her black belt.  We're all excited to see her participate in a tournament, but she insists she's not good enough yet.  Oh pooh, I think she's being modest.

When we get back to Sunset Valley it will be Sam's elder birthday and mine will be a few days after that.  We've already agreed that we won't have a party for either one of us because I simply cannot bear to risk another visit from Grim so soon.  Sam has also been making noises about completing his lifetime wish - he's 2/3 of the way there.  I may have to send him off to France to chase that dream.  If I know him, he'll set us up with a lovely home there, too.

But for now I'm going to relax and enjoy our family vacation...there will be time to think about those things when we get home.

Jori Looks Good in Black

Hi Grandpa,

I hope you aren't too lonely there in Sunset Valley without Jemma and I to keep you company.  We made it to Shang Simla just fine.  You should see the house, it's like a palace!  Mom couldn't believe her eyes when she saw it.  Dad put in a state of the art TV and computer so Jemma can work on her skills.  She's already level 6 in gardening and fishing without even lifting a finger.  Who would believe you could sit around the house all day and still prepare for your career?!  She says she's going to be a famous scientist and with her brains I'm sure she will.

Mom and Dad have been painting and sculpting like there's no tomorrow.  I've lost track of how many paintings dad has tucked away to bring to the consignment shop when we get back.  I hope the airline doesn't charge him extra for all of it.

I've been spending every day at the Academy practicing my sim fu.  I start out by meditating in the morning in the beautiful zen garden Dad built for me.



Then it's time to break boards and train with the practice dummy.




Once I made it to level 7 I started competing in ranked sparring tournaments at the Academy.  I've got a good record so far, Grandpa, you would be proud of me. 

My last match today was really special.  I was paired up against an amazing black belt.  He looked to be about your age, but boy was he tough.  I won the first round but he tied it up in the second.  It all came down to the third round.  I was so tired by that time.  I've faced some tough opponents, but no one like him.  It was really close, but I managed to claim a victory.



Later that same day I was fooling around breaking some space rocks and I earned my level 10 black belt!



I'm one and a half ranks from becoming a grand master and achieving my lifetime wish.  With a little bit of luck I should be able to wrap it up before we leave for home.

I wish you had decided to come with us, I think you would have had a great time.  Our neighbors are teaching us to eat using chopsticks.  Jemma and I are pretty good at it now, but Mom and Dad are hopeless.



Oh yeah, I almost forgot, they threw a party to get to know more of our neighbors.  Mom kept saying something about needing more friends.  I don't get it, but whatever, it was a fun time.



I can't wait to see you, Grandpa!  Oh yeah, Jemma and I have a surprise for you...we found a pair of Chinese gnomes!  I'm leaving mine here to watch our house when we leave and Jemma is bringing hers home to keep the rest of our little friends company.



I gotta go now.  Dad is hollering at me to pick up around here.  I guess we're having more company tonight.  I miss you lots!  If you see Grandpa Leighton tell him I miss him, too.  See you in a week and a half!

Love,

Jori
